incoctĭlis
incoctĭlis, e, adj. incoquo. * Cooked in any thing: incoctile ἐνεψημένον, Gloss. Philox.—* Transf., subst.: in-coctĭlĭa, ium, n. (sc. vasa), vessels overlaid or washed with metal, tinned vessels, Plin. 34, 17, 48, § 162.
